MotoGP: Marc Márquez and brother Álex celebrate titles in Cervera

In what has become something of a tradition, Marc Márquez shared his eighth World Championship win in his hometown of Cervera this Saturday, with the thousands of fans who flooded the streets once again. The Repsol Honda Team rider was the protagonist, together with his brother Álex, as the pair celebrated their respective MotoGP and Moto2 world titles.

After a press conference held at the University of Cervera, the MotoGP World Champion began a parade uploaded to the float that his fan club had prepared for the occasion. Márquez was accompanied by the family and team members who helped him to become an eight-time World Champion in the 25th anniversary year of the most successful MotoGP team: Repsol Honda.

The party ended, like every year, with the float arriving at a stage from which the rider addressed the fans. Cervera’s most famous citizen is as popular as ever in his hometown as his success continues.
